So then travel between krynn and Toril is possible?During earlier editions, and with the structure of the Great Wheel cosmology, travel between Krynn and Toril was possible -- either through planar means, or just standard spelljamming. And indeed, there are noted instances in the lore as Rino indicates above.

With the evolution of the Great Tree however, and the new cosmology for the DRAGONLANCE setting... things eventually changed. The presence of Sigil in a separate "planar pocket" [Rich Baker has confirmed this] which allowed access to most cosmologies could, in theory, allow travellers to journey from one setting to the other. Though, until this particular reference in Grand History, we had no specific lore in 3e -- for either setting -- suggesting this was anything more than a theory. The fact that a kender's presence has still been supported in 3e Realmslore does indeed work toward confirming the theory that travel, through the City of Doors, is still possible between Krynn and Toril even considering the changes to the cosmological frameworks of both settings.
